Safety first in chemical manufacture

Autotype International is proud of its safe and environmentally responsible practices in the manufacture of speciality films and chemicals.

Autotype International is proud of its safe and environmentally responsible manufacture of speciality films and chemicals for the electronics industry, screen printing, digital display printing and industrial applications In these times of increased environmental awareness and with legislation driving continual developments to reduce hazards in the workplace, Autotype has established some of the most comprehensive procedures and environmental protection measures of any manufacturer is its field Over the past year Autotype has introduced the HAZOP (hazard and operability studies) risk assessment technique

This procedure, which has been used to identify and minimise risk from all operations using significant quantities of solvents, was introduced in conjunction with the University of Manchester's Institute of Science and Technology under the auspices of the Institute of Chemical Engineers.

The development follows a series of initiatives introduced by the firm which include reducing solvent emissions to atmosphere by 92% since 1992 through best practice technology and recycling 200t of wood, paper, metal and plastic packaging.

The company has also reduced its vehicle fuel consumption by 65% since 1992.

Autotype received recognition of its commitment towards conserving the environment by becoming the first supplier of its kind to be accredited to the international standard for Environmental Management Systems ISO14001 (receiving full accreditation in 1996).

It has also been awarded the British Safety Council Safety Award on seven separate occasions.

An extract from the company's General Environmental Policy reads: "It is the policy of the company to continuously review and improve its manufacturing operations, products and services consistent with the protection and conservation of the environment.

Environmental issues are treated by the company as having equal importance to matters related to health and safety".

Autotype takes this very seriously and a subcommittee of the International Board meets several times a year to set and monitor policies and targets.

The extract also notes: "Targets and objectives for improved environmental performance will be set and reviewed on an annual basis to ensure continual advancement.

These will be available to employees and the public".

As a proof of this commitment, environmental data is featured in the autotype.com website, where visitors can access up-to-date statistics on the company's performance in this area.

The company's commitment towards conservation is to be at the leading edge of best practice and its policy "is to regard compliance with the requirements of relevant environment legislation as a minimum standard", particularly regarding effluent control and atmospheric emissions.

In its local community more than GBP 30,000 has been spent on drainage interception tanks to provide a second level of protection to minimise any possibility of pollution of the environmentally sensitive Letcombe Brook that runs in front of Autotype's factory.
